Printed statutes of other states to be received in evidence.

490.020. Printed books or pamphlets purporting on their face to be the session or other statutes of any of the United States, or the territories thereof, or of any foreign jurisdiction, and to have been printed and published by the authority of any such state, territory or foreign jurisdiction or proved to be commonly recognized in its courts shall be received in the courts of this state as prima facie evidence of such statutes.

(RSMo 1939 1817, A.L. 1949 p. 275)

Prior revisions: 1929 1653; 1919 5340; 1909 6285
